Heart Medicine

Mobility with Kayla Nielsen

Heart Medicine is a 4 week back bending series. The intention of this series it to increase strength, flexibility, and functional mobility through a blend of back bend focused drills and full flows. Additionally, we will wor... more

Frequently Asked Questions

What level is this series?
Generally intermediate level classes, although some of the classes are also suitable for beginners. Please check all descriptions for complete details.
Can I try this series if I'm new to back bends?
You can definitely try the drills, meditations, and pranayamas! However, I'd only enter into the full flows if you consider your yoga practice to be intermediate.
What postures will we work on in this series?
Peak Postures: Camel, Kapotasana, Wild Thing, Wild Thing to Wheel, Dancer, King Pigeon, Floor Bow, King Dancer.
What parts of the body are we focusing on in this series?
Leg strength, core strength, hip mobility, core strength, chest opening, shoulder opening, back strength.
